Jurassic Park Junior High English Composition One

Title: My Visit to Jurassic Park

Last summer, my family and I had the incredible opportunity to visit Jurassic Park. It was a dream come true for me as I have always been fascinated by dinosaurs. The park is located on a remote island and is known for its realistic and interactive dinosaur exhibits. The moment we stepped foot on the island, I could feel the excitement building up inside me.

The first thing that caught my attention was the enormous T-Rex statue at the entrance. It was a perfect replica of the fearsome predator that once roamed the Earth. As we walked further into the park, we saw various species of dinosaurs in their respective habitats. The park had recreated different ecosystems, allowing the dinosaurs to live in environments similar to their natural habitats.

One of the highlights of our visit was the dinosaur feeding show. We watched in awe as the park staff approached a herd of herbivorous dinosaurs with buckets of food. The dinosaurs eagerly devoured the plants, and it was incredible to see their massive jaws and teeth up close. The park staff also explained interesting facts about each dinosaur species, making the experience both educational and entertaining.

Another thrilling activity was the dinosaur ride. We boarded a jeep that took us on a guided tour through the park. Along the way, we encountered animatronic dinosaurs that moved and roared, creating a truly immersive experience. It felt as if we were traveling back in time, witnessing these ancient creatures in their natural habitat.

Apart from the exhibits and rides, the park also had a fossil excavation site. Here, visitors could participate in a simulated excavation and uncover replicas of dinosaur bones. I was thrilled to dig in the sand and uncover a dinosaur rib bone. It was like being a paleontologist for a day!

In conclusion, my visit to Jurassic Park was an unforgettable experience. The park not only provided entertainment but also allowed me to learn more about dinosaurs and their habitats. It was a unique opportunity to witness the grandeur and magnificence of these prehistoric creatures up close. I will cherish the memories of this trip for a lifetime and hope to visit Jurassic Park again someday.

Jurassic Park Junior High English Composition Two

Title: The Importance of Preserving Jurassic Park

Jurassic Park is not just an amusement park; it is a place of scientific significance and educational value. The preservation of Jurassic Park is crucial for the preservation of dinosaur history and for the advancement of scientific knowledge.

Firstly, Jurassic Park provides a unique opportunity for scientists and paleontologists to study dinosaurs in a realistic and interactive environment. The park's realistic dinosaur replicas and recreated habitats allow researchers to observe and analyze the behavior and characteristics of these extinct creatures. By studying dinosaurs in such a setting, scientists can gain insights into their biology, evolution, and interactions with their environment.

Secondly, Jurassic Park serves as an educational resource for children and adults alike. The park offers various educational programs and exhibits that teach visitors about the history of dinosaurs and the importance of conservation. By visiting the park, people can learn about the different dinosaur species, their diets, and their role in the Earth's ecosystem millions of years ago. This knowledge helps raise awareness about the importance of biodiversity and the need to protect our planet's natural heritage.

Furthermore, Jurassic Park contributes to the tourism industry, bringing economic benefits to the local community. The park attracts visitors from all over the world, generating revenue for the island and creating job opportunities for the local population. This economic boost can help improve infrastructure, education, and healthcare in the surrounding areas, ultimately benefiting the community as a whole.

In conclusion, the preservation of Jurassic Park is not just about entertainment; it is about preserving our planet's history and advancing scientific knowledge. The park provides a unique opportunity for research, education, and economic growth. By supporting the preservation of Jurassic Park, we are ensuring that future generations will have the chance to learn about and appreciate the wonders of dinosaurs. It is our responsibility to protect and preserve this invaluable resource for the benefit of present and future generations.
